  • How secure are my dealings with Alumni.NET? How secure is Alumni.NET's Technical System?

Alumni.NET uses multiple custom-built servers running on secure and reliable OS as well as highly-scalable, enterprise-class mail software. Member data on the servers is stored on RAID sub-systems to ensure integrity, availability, and fast access. All servers are monitored 24 hours a day to ensure maximum uptime and performance. A world-class facility houses the servers, with raised floors, HVAC temperature control systems, seismically braced racks, fire suppression systems, fully redundant power on the premises, and multiple backup generator systems for crisis and disaster protection.

The facility is connected to the network backbone from multiple sources for the highest level of reliability through BGP (Border Gateway Protocol), which routes information to networks by the shortest and fastest route possible. A 100% network headroom policy is maintained, eliminating the concern for network congestion. This means that additional backbone and intra-network capacity is provisioned when 50% utilization is achieved. The industry standard, closer to 80%, would allow possible line saturation.

  • SPAM Prevention

Spamming of members is prevented by a database system that never shows the e-mail addresses of its members. Members are able to send messages to each other through the use of website forms. Only registered members of Alumni.NET may send messages to other members of the site. Only registered alumni can post articles on the discussion boards. These measures make it more difficult to abuse the information in this site. However, Alumni.NET shall in no way be liable for any losses or damages suffered because of use or misuse of the site.
